Recommending Dorohedoro manga

Alright it took me some months to finish dorohedoro. I enjoyed all the 167.5 chapters. I always had a feeling while reading this manga that "in the end what if I didn't understand the story". Because of the magic powers and the story itself kinda feels like a non linear movie. It took me some time to understand the magic powers and the basic storyline to continue reading. I felt this feeling while i started and around 90-100 chapters i understand the basic plot. This could be a reason for some readers to drop this manga but guess what "EVERY PIECES 🧩 WILL CONNECT IN THE END". The ending was so satisfying. fun fact it's so crazy that the author somewhat managed to keep most of the main characters alive 😆 except matsumara 🙃

As Good as It Gets(1997)

This movie is awesome one of the best feel good movie i came across this week. Now they were three main stories but again i think the carol spencer story ended when udall funded money for her son. And about simon after he got badly injured by the robbers he needs a spark to draw again and Carol gave the spark. But the whole movie revolves around udall about how an OCD person handles many things in his life. and there were many sweet spots like udall getting friendly with the dog is the first thing he started to come out of the OCD. And the next three things would be in the last part of the movie where Udall lets Simon stay inside his apartment room and my favourite sweet spot is "HE FORGETS TO LOCK THE DOOR". he always locks the door three times. And the last thing is udall making a move on Carol. And there are many subtle moments in this movie. Maybe only the OCD was able to feel it and notice it. The movie was amazing carol and Simon character writing is good. And udall simply carrying this whole movie with his acting his character writing was amazing. The music is cool and yeah its a good movie

Goodfellas(1990)

Man this movie is a masterpiece. This has to be one of the finest work of Martin Scorsese. After reading the wiseguy book and getting the character ideas and story for the movie. Martin Scorsese must have met the real gangster in real life. Just to know how a gangster would walk how a gangster would eat and how a gangster would light a cigarette. I mean god damn the details in the movie were amazing. Mind blowing fast paced screenplay amazing music i love the music they played at the end of the movie. And the character redemption arc was just perfect it's just perfect. More than that the details in this movie of how the gangster and the mafia thing works. It was one hell of a ride ngl.

My favourite dialogue in this movie would be "As far back as I can remember, I always wanted to be a gangster." This is iconic and my favourite character would be SPIDER the bartender guy. and my favourite scene is spider after getting insulted by tommy he will say "fuck off yourself tommy" at that time I felt like spider looks more like a gangster than the henry tommy and Jimmy

Hands down Karen hill has to be one of the loyal person in this whole movie. She knows henry has an affair she gets henry bailed out by throwing his mom's house. She's far better than Skyler white in breaking bad on the movie she was loyal. But then in the end after 25 years of marriage karlen hill separated herself from henry because of not having the luxury life and money they had before i think so...

Once again the detailing every character arc writing was mind blowing left me out of speech this is masterpiece
